Practical, Clinical and Communication Skills in Stomatology

The Head of the Educational Program Stomatology, Manana Ustiashvili, held the meeting with the teaching staff. The discussion of the teaching strategies and methods of the practical, clinical and communication skills to the Stomatology program students was the main part of the meeting. The main attention was concentrated on the development of these skills among students via Objectively Structured Practical Exam (OSPE), Objectively Clinical Practical Exam (OSCE), teaching via Standardized Patient, teaching in the Simulations Lab, etc. The main focus was on the Objectively Structured Clinical Exam, as it has the leading part in the assessment system.

To develop practical, clinical and communication skills among students is the main target of the program and this concept is shared among KWIU’s administrative, academic and invited staff. The same components are requested outlined in the employers survey as well.
